The Work
What You'll Focus On
- •Bank + compliance workflows: diligence calls, documentation, tracking requirements, and unblocking stakeholders
- •Customer onboarding support: coordinating KYB readiness, launch timelines, and weekly customer status
- •Partnership execution: keeping external partner threads moving (PMS, banks, vendors) with tight next steps
- •Internal operating cadence: weekly planning, KPI dashboarding, and decision memos
- •Hiring & recruiting ops: pipeline management, scheduling, scorecards, and candidate experience
- •Special projects: high-impact initiatives that don't neatly fit into a single function, owned end-to-end
What You'll Do
- •Help drive cross-functional execution: coordinate Product/Eng, Ops, Compliance, and GTM to hit launch and onboarding timelines
- •Own a single tracker for key company threads (bank launch, design partners, product milestones, hiring) and keep it current
- •Write and maintain crisp internal docs: decision memos, project plans, customer launch plans, KPI updates
- •Communicate with external stakeholders (bank partners, vendors, customers) to keep work moving and unblock decisions
- •Identify bottlenecks early and fix them (process, ownership, escalation, or resourcing)
- •Create leverage: automate recurring workflows, templates, and systems so the team moves faster with less chaos
